/******* Do not edit this file *******
Simple Custom CSS and JS - by Silkypress.com
Saved: Jan 07 2026 | 16:26:57 */
.header {
	background-image: url("https://newp.across.it/wp-content/uploads/2025/04/across-background-home.svg");
}

h1, h2, h3, h4, h5, h6, #menu {
  font-family: 'Bricolage Grotesque', sans-serif;
}

h3 sup.small{
	font-size:0.8vw ;
	font-weight: 800 !important;
	letter-spacing: -0.08em !important
}


@media screen and (max-width: 980px) {
     h3 sup.small{
		font-size:2vw ;
	} 
}

@media screen and (max-width: 479px) {
     h3 sup.small{
		font-size:3.5vw ;
	} 
	a.ac-btn-blog {
	padding:0.3rem 2em !important;
	}
}


p {
	font-weight:500;
}

.primary-text {
	color: #60b158;
}
.secondary-text {
	color: #8cd4bc;
}

.primary-link {
	color: #60b158;
	text-decoration: underline;
}
.secondary-link {
	color: #8cd4bc;
	text-decoration: underline;
}

.perfomance-text {
	color: #D46A8B !important;
}
/* button */
a.ac-btn, a.ac-btn-neg, a.ac-btn-lrg, a.ac-btn-sm-pink, a.ac-btn-sm-orange, a.ac-btn-sm-grey, a.ac-btn-sm-seagreen {
	
}

a.ac-btn-sml {
	border-top: 0.5px solid #000000;
	border-right: 0.5px solid #000000;
	border-bottom: 2px solid #000000;
	border-left: 2px solid #000000;	
	color:#ffffff;
	background-color:#60b158;
	border-radius: 5px;
	padding:2px 8px 0;
}

a.ac-btn-blog {
	border-top: 0.5px solid #000000;
	border-right: 0.5px solid #000000;
	border-bottom: 2px solid #000000;
	border-left: 2px solid #000000;	
	color:#ffffff;
	background-color:#000000;
	border-radius: 16px;
	padding:0.3rem 6rem;
}
a.ac-btn-blog:hover {
	border-top: 1px solid #000000;
	border-right: 1px solid #000000;
	border-bottom: 1px solid #000000;
	border-left: 1px solid #000000;	
	color:#000000;
	background-color:#60b158;
	border-radius: 16px;
	padding:0.3rem 6rem;
}


a.ac-btn {
	border-top: 0.5px solid #000000;
	border-right: 0.5px solid #000000;
	border-bottom: 2px solid #000000;
	border-left: 2px solid #000000;	
	color:#ffffff;
	background-color:#60b158;
	border-radius: 5px;
	padding:4px 16px 0;
}

a.ac-btn-neg {
	border-top: 0.5px solid #8CD4BC;
	border-right: 0.5px solid #8CD4BC;
	border-bottom: 2px solid #8CD4BC;
	border-left: 2px solid #8CD4BC;	 
	color:#8CD4BC;
	border-radius: 5px;
	padding:4px 16px 0;
}




a.ac-btn-lrg {
	border-top: 0.5px solid #000000;
	border-right: 0.5px solid #000000;
	border-bottom: 2px solid #000000;
	border-left: 2px solid #000000;	 
	color:#ffffff;
	background-color:#60b158;
	border-radius: 5px;
	padding:4px 16px 0;
}
a.ac-btn-white {
	border-top: 0.5px solid #000;
	border-right: 0.5px solid #000;
	border-bottom: 2px solid #000;
	border-left: 2px solid #000;	
	background: #fff;
	color:#000;
	border-radius: 5px;
	padding:4px 16px 0;
}

a.ac-btn-white:hover {
	border-top: 2px solid #fff;
	border-right: 2px solid #fff;
	border-bottom: 0.5px solid #fff;
	border-left: 0.5px solid #fff;	
	color:#fff;
	background: none;
}


a.ac-btn:hover, a.ac-btn-lrg:hover, a.ac-btn-neg:hover {
	border-top: 2px solid #000000;
	border-right: 2px solid #000000;
	border-bottom: 0.5px solid #000000;
	border-left: 0.5px solid #000000;	
	color:#000000;
	background-color:#ffffff;
	padding:4px 16px 0;
	
}
/* button b-unit home*/
a.ac-btn-sm-pink, a.ac-btn-sm-orange, a.ac-btn-sm-grey, a.ac-btn-sm-seagreen{
	border-top: 0.5px solid #000000;
	border-right: 0.5px solid #000000;
	border-bottom: 2px solid #000000;
	border-left: 2px solid #000000;	 
	font-weight: 600;	
	border-radius: 5px;
	padding:2px 8px 0;
}
a.ac-btn-sm-pink {
	color:#ffffff;
	background-color:#D46A8B;
	padding:2px 8px 0;
}

a.ac-btn-sm-orange {	
	border-radius: 5px;
	color:#000000;
	background-color:#FFAB40;
	padding:2px 8px 0;
}

a.ac-btn-sm-grey {
	color:#ffffff;
	background-color:#595959;
	padding:2px 8px 0;
}
a.ac-btn-sm-seagreen {
	color:#000000;
	background-color:#2CB889;
	padding:2px 8px 0;
}

a.ac-btn-sm-pink:hover, a.ac-btn-sm-orange:hover, a.ac-btn-sm-grey:hover, a.ac-btn-sm-seagreen:hover {
	border-top: 2px solid #000000;
	border-right: 2px solid #000000;
	border-bottom: 0.5px solid #000000;
	border-left: 0.5px solid #000000;
	color:#000000;
	background-color:#ffffff;
	padding:2px 8px 0;
	}
a.link-footer:hover{
	color:#8cd4bc;
}